I have nothing left to win, Undertaker says goodbye to WWE

Announcing his retirement, The Undertaker, a world-renowned WWE freestyle wrestler, said: “I no longer have the desire to fight, I have nothing left to win.” Entering the ring wearing a black hat, The Undertaker’s real name is Mark Callaway, who has entertained fans around the world for almost 30 years. Nohemi Carabali suspended for anti-doping violation

The International Paralympic Committee (IPC) has suspended Colombian powerlifter Nohemi Carabali for four years for committing an anti-doping violation. The athlete who competes in the up to 50kg returned an adverse analytical finding for three prohibited substances in a urine sample provided on 14 July 2019 after competing at the Nur-Sultan 2019 World Para Powerlifting Championships in Kazakhstan. Inam makes Pakistan proud again, wins gold at World Beach Games

DOHA/KARACHI: Pakistan’s champion wrestler Inam Butt added another feather to his cap on Monday when he bagged gold at the World Beach Games in Doha, Qatar. Inam, 30, remained undefeated throughout the day in 90kg weight category of wrestling competition to outclass all his opponents. Champions return home from Commonwealth Games

LAHORE: The Pakistani wrestling team returned home today, after winning gold and bronze at the Commonwealth Games in Gold Coast, Australia. Inam Butt gave Pakistan their lone gold medal of the tournament in the wrestling event at the games while Tayyab Raza and Mohammad Bilal won bronze for Pakistan. Wrestler Mohammad Inam wins Pakistan’s first Gold at Commonwealth Games

Mohammad Inam celebrating after his win – screengrab  Wrestler Mohammad Inam Butt has once again kept Pakistan’s flag high by winning the Gold medal at the Commonwealth Games Wrestling competition on Saturday. 29-year-old Inam, also a gold medalist of Delhi Commonwealth Games in 2010, completely outclassed his opponent Melvin Bibo of Nigeria in the final of 86kg weight category. Saudi Arabia’s top sports body announces 10-year deal with WWE

Riyadh:-Saudis will soon get to watch World Wrestling Entertainment (WWE) matches live in the kingdom, as the country’s sports authority has signed an exclusive deal with the entertainment brand. According to Arab News, the Saudi General Sports Authority has signed a 10-year deal with the WWE corporation to hold wrestling events in the kingdom.
